Overview

Our integrated circuits and reference designs help you create next-generation ultrasound smart probes that maintain optimal image quality while consuming minimal power.

Design requirements

Innovative ultrasound smart probes often require:

  • High performance, ultra-low power, integrated front-end for Rx/Tx signal chain.
  • High efficiency, low-noise power supply that maintains image SNR.
  • Ultra-small size to fit in handheld transducer form factor.
